Ole Rømer, 50 Danish Kroner (1936)

This note is now obsolete.


 

Urbain Jean Joseph Le Verrier, 50 French Francs (1947)

This note is now obsolete.

Charles Darwin, 10 British Pounds (2005)

This note is still legal currency and is still in print.


 

George Stephenson, 5 British Pounds (1990)

This note is out of print, and has been taken out of circulation.

Adam Smith, 50 Britsh Pounds, Clydesdale Bank, (2003)

This note is still legal currency and is of the most recent printing.


 

Pedro Nunes, 100 Portuguese Escudos (1957)

This note is now obsolete.

Janez Vajkard Valvasor, 20 Slovenian Tolarjev (1992)

This note is now obsolete.

 

Atomium, 20 Belgian Francs (1964)

This note is now obsolete. Atomium is of course not a person, it is the structure of iron crystals (body-centered cubic).

Abu Ali al-Hasan Ibn al-Haitham, 10 Iraqi Dinar (1982)

This note is now obsolete.


 

Abu Ali al-Hasan Ibn al-Haitham, 10000 Iraqi Dinar (2005)

This note is still legal currency and is still in print.

Ozone Depletion, 100 Antarctican Dollars (2001)

This note is now obsolete. Okay, it's not 'real' currency in the sense that Antarctica does not have a bank; it was a fund raiser. See the print on the left-hand side of the banknote under the 100.


 

Total Solar Eclipse, 2000 Romanian Lei (1999)

This note is now obsolete. This note commemorates the total solar eclipse visible over Romania in 1999. On the back is a map of Romania with the eclipse path.

US Space Shuttle, 5 British Pounds, Northern Bank (1999)

This note is out of print, and is being taken out of circulation.

 

Aryabhata Satellite, 2 Indian Rupees (1983)

This note is now obsolete. The satellite is named after the Indian mathematician Aryabhata. (Thanks to Miranda Movin for pointing this out to me!)
